Description

Demonstrate the principles of heat transfer clearly and safely with these Thermal Conductivity Bars, designed for use with a beaker and hot water only—no open flame required. The set features four common metals: Copper, Brass, Aluminium, and Steel, making it ideal for comparing thermal conductivity in an educational or laboratory setting.

Instructions:

Each bar measures 200 x 50 x 6 mm and includes a visual indicator system that provides an effective, easy-to-observe display. Simply fill a beaker with hot water (60 °C or higher), immerse the exposed end of the bars, and observe the colour change along each metal. As heat travels through the material, the 1 cm blackish squares gradually become more transparent or brighter, clearly showing differences in conductivity between metals.
